Budget 6.0 Build
I'm picking up a 01+ LQ4 to swap into my 88 Monte SS. Its a weeked warrior that will see the 1/4. Car weighs 3450lbs.
Trans is a built 2004r, 3200 stall (may step it up a little), 4.10 gears, and Hoosier slicks. I'll be running an Edelbrock Victor Jr intake, Holley double pumper, MSD 6010 controller, and 1 3/4" longtubes.
Motor will remain stock besides a set of ARP rod bolts and cam/pushrods/springs.
Few questions. Whats the max lift the stock long block safely handle?
Also, I'm searching for a cam and there seems to be hundreds out there. I've been looking at Thunderracing especially since they have a kit with springs/pushrods/valve seals/cam.
I'm wondering how the 230/236 112 .592/.602 would perform with stock heads? Or possibly an F13?
What kind of rwhp numbers could I expect? I'm looking to run as fast as I can while keeping the motor in one piece. I'll upgrade the heads possibly next winter but for now, its gonna be a stock longblock with a cam.
